Transaction 12bddc66f4127138bde66cdbcfa84d7268e0f6d7eb2eed68bbc915129179fe10

1 Input
2 Outputs
  • 12bddc66f4127138bde66cdbcfa84d7268e0f6d7eb2eed68bbc915129179fe10:0
  • value  29993366
    address  35C35GxkH2KDVeXwfzk92vTLezLaSa6Scy
  • 12bddc66f4127138bde66cdbcfa84d7268e0f6d7eb2eed68bbc915129179fe10:1
  • value  57250834
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c